DIRECTIONS FOR USE :
DO NOT USE ON PUPPIES UNDER 3 MONTHS OF AGE.
Dosage
For dogs less than 60 kg in weight, use a single pipette from a pack indicated for dogs of the appropriate weight range. For dogs over 60 kg, pipettes of
different volumes may be combined to provide a suitable dose.
Application
Break the snap-off top from the pipette along the scored line. Choose an area where licking cannot occur e.g. on the back of the neck. Part the coat until the
skin is visible. Place the tip of the pipette on the skin and squeeze several times to empty its contents directly on to the skin. Take care to avoid excessive
wetting of the hair as this will leave a sticky appearance of hairs at the treatment spot. However, if this should occur, it will disappear within 24 hours after
036 002377 - A 0007




application.
Fleas (Ctenocephalides felis) and Flea Allergy Dermatitis : For the treatment and prevention of flea infestation for one month on dogs, apply the entire
contents of one pipette as directed. For ongoing flea control use FRONTLINEĀ® TOP SPOT monthly. For control of flea allergy dermatitis, apply monthly to the
affected dog and to all other cats and dogs in the household.
Paralysis Tick (Ixodes holocyclus) : For the control of Paralysis Tick infestations on dogs for up to 2 weeks, apply the entire contents of one pipette as
directed. While FRONTLINEĀ® TOP SPOT provides control of Paralysis Ticks, use of the product does not guarantee prevention of tick paralysis because ticks are
not killed immediately after attachment. Following application, daily searching of dogs for ticks must continue, to minimise the risk of tick paralysis. See your
veterinarian for advice on searching techniques.
Brown Dog Tick (Rhipicephalus sanguineus) : For the control of Brown Dog Ticks on dogs for up to 1 month, apply the entire contents of one pipette as
directed.
NOT TO BE USED FOR ANY PURPOSE, OR IN ANY MANNER, CONTRARY TO THIS LABEL UNLESS AUTHORISED UNDER APPROPRIATE
LEGISLATION.
For use only on dogs.
Further Information : It is recommended not to bath or shampoo the animal during the 48 hours after treatment with FRONTLINEĀ® TOP SPOT. The product will
spread over the coat of the animal within 24 hours. Once spread FRONTLINEĀ® TOP SPOT is water fast and regular water immersions will not adversely affect
its activity. In paralysis tick areas, daily searching to prevent tick paralysis is necessary during the paralysis tick season. The season is approximately from
Spring to Autumn but may be year-round in tropical areas. Consult your veterinarian for local information on tick prevalence.
FRONTLINEĀ® may be used as the only product for flea control as it breaks the life cycle and kills fleas emerging from the environment to reinfest the dog. If more
rapid resolution of heavy environmental infestations is required, additional environmental control using a registered premises treatment may be implemented.
Do not use FRONTLINEĀ® TOP SPOT if you or your pet have a known hypersensitivity to insecticides or alcohol.
